Description

Non-essential nuclear protein; null mutation has global effects on transcription; VHR2 has a paralog, VHR1, that arose from the whole genome duplication; relative distribution to the nucleus increases upon DNA replication stress [Source:SGD;Acc:S000000866]

Location

Chromosome V: 282,705-284,222 reverse strand.
